Hundreds enjoy rally thrills

Hundreds of Barbadians, like Nicholas Walkes  turned out to watch yesterday’s opening stages of the Sol Rally Barbados 2010.And they were not disappointed! Competition was fierce among the drivers which saw England’s Paul Bird and his navigator Kirsty Riddick of Scotland ]take the pole position. The bright green of the Ford Focus WRC07whizzed through the countryside at death-defying speeds, with Bird taking advantage of a puncture suffered by local favourite Paul “The Surfer” Bourne.The event concludes today.
